Match Commentary

  • 22': Matt Grimes (Swansea City)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
  • 45'+2': First Half ends, Millwall 0, Swansea City 0.
  • 45': Second Half begins Millwall 0, Swansea City 0.
  • 46': Goal! Millwall 0, Swansea City 1. Joël Piroe (Swansea City) right footed shot from the centre of the box to the bottom right corner.
  • 49': Joel Latibeaudiere (Swansea City)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
  • 60': Substitution, Millwall. Maikel Kieftenbeld replaces Tom Bradshaw.
  • 60': Substitution, Millwall. Oliver Burke replaces George Saville.
  • 63': Substitution, Swansea City. Olivier Ntcham replaces Hannes Wolf.
  • 78': Substitution, Swansea City. Jamie Paterson replaces Joël Piroe.
  • 79': Substitution, Swansea City. Korey Smith replaces Jay Fulton.
  • 79': Substitution, Millwall. Sheyi Ojo replaces Jed Wallace.
  • 82': Danny Ballard (Millwall)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
